What We Offer:

Novant Health is building a premier Community Health & Wellness Institute (CHAWI) across the South Carolina region, with a focus on Hilton Head, Bluffton, and Beaufort markets.

We are actively developing a pipeline of Primary Care and outpatient specialty physicians to support continued growth across our expanding network of community-based clinics and ambulatory care sites.

This is an opportunity to be part of a high-growth, community-focused, program-building environment with strong leadership support, modern facilities, and a commitment to delivering accessible, patient-centered care across the continuum.

 

Opportunities across multiple specialties, including:

  • Family Medicine
  • Internal Medicine
  • Geriatrics
  • Dermatology
  • Endocrinology
  • Rheumatology
  • Other outpatient-focused specialties
